Risk Mitigation: Protect against unforeseen events like cancellations, delays, or medical emergencies
When planning your honeymoon, considering travel insurance is a wise decision that can provide a safety net for unforeseen circumstances. Unforeseen events such as trip cancellations, delays, or medical emergencies can disrupt your travel plans and potentially lead to significant financial losses. Here's how travel insurance can help mitigate these risks:
Cancellations and Interruptions: Life can be unpredictable, and sometimes, even after meticulous planning, you might need to cancel or interrupt your honeymoon. Travel insurance can offer financial protection in such scenarios. It typically covers non-refundable costs associated with trip cancellations or interruptions due to covered reasons like illness, injury, or severe weather events. This coverage ensures that you don't lose the entire cost of your trip if you need to cancel unexpectedly. For example, if a sudden medical emergency forces you to cancel your honeymoon, travel insurance can reimburse you for the non-refundable portions of your trip, including flights, accommodations, and tour bookings.
Travel Delays: Delays can be frustrating and often beyond your control, especially during a romantic getaway. Travel insurance can provide compensation for additional expenses incurred due to delays, such as overnight hotel stays, meals, and transportation to reach your next destination. This coverage ensures that you're not left with unexpected costs when your travel plans are disrupted. For instance, if a flight delay causes you to miss a connecting flight, travel insurance might cover the additional expenses of an overnight stay and transportation to the next available flight.
Medical Emergencies: Honeymoons often involve exploring new places, and while you may be excited, it's essential to be prepared for potential health issues. Travel insurance offers medical coverage, including emergency medical treatment, hospitalization, and even medical evacuation if necessary. This is particularly crucial when visiting countries with limited healthcare infrastructure or higher healthcare costs. In the event of a medical emergency, travel insurance can provide peace of mind, ensuring you receive the necessary treatment without incurring substantial out-of-pocket expenses.
Additionally, travel insurance can also cover trip interruption benefits, which allow you to cut your trip short due to a covered reason and return home without incurring additional costs. This is especially relevant if a medical emergency or a natural disaster occurs, forcing you to leave your honeymoon prematurely.

Medical Coverage: Include medical expenses and emergency evacuations for peace of mind
When planning your honeymoon, it's easy to get caught up in the excitement of your upcoming adventure. However, it's crucial to consider the importance of travel insurance, especially when it comes to medical coverage. Here's why including medical expenses and emergency evacuations in your insurance plan is essential for a stress-free and worry-free trip:
Medical Expenses: Unforeseen medical emergencies can arise during any travel, and honeymoons are no exception. Medical costs abroad can be significantly higher than at home. A simple illness or injury could result in substantial expenses, including doctor visits, medications, and hospital stays. Travel insurance with comprehensive medical coverage ensures that you are financially protected. It covers the costs of necessary treatments, consultations, and medications, allowing you to focus on your recovery without the added stress of financial burdens. For instance, if you or your partner experience a sudden illness or injury during your honeymoon, having medical coverage means you won't have to worry about the financial implications of seeking medical attention.
Emergency Evacuations: Honeymoons often involve exploring new and potentially remote locations. While these destinations may offer breathtaking views and unique experiences, they can also present challenges in terms of medical access and emergency services. In the event of a severe medical emergency or an accident that requires specialized care, emergency evacuation coverage is invaluable. This aspect of travel insurance arranges for your immediate medical evacuation to a facility capable of providing the necessary treatment. It ensures that you receive the best possible care, even in the most remote areas, and can be transported to a hospital or medical facility of your choice, often back home or to a location of your preference. This level of coverage provides peace of mind, knowing that you are protected against the high costs and logistical complexities of emergency medical evacuations.

Luggage and Belongings: Safeguard against loss, theft, or damage to personal items
When embarking on your honeymoon, it's natural to be excited and eager to explore new places. However, it's crucial to prioritize the safety of your belongings to ensure a stress-free and enjoyable trip. Here are some essential tips to safeguard your luggage and personal items during your romantic getaway:
Pack Securely: Start by investing in a high-quality, sturdy suitcase or backpack designed to withstand travel. Look for features like reinforced zippers, tamper-proof locks, and water-resistant materials. Consider using a luggage strap with a built-in combination lock to secure your bag, making it more difficult for thieves to access its contents. Additionally, pack your valuables, such as jewelry, cameras, and expensive electronics, in a hidden pouch or money belt that can be discreetly worn under your clothes. This way, you reduce the risk of attracting unwanted attention.
Keep Your Luggage Close: Be vigilant and keep your luggage within your sight at all times. Avoid leaving it unattended in public places, and always use a luggage tag or identifier that includes your contact information. In crowded areas, consider using a money belt or a hidden pouch to store your passport, cash, and other essential documents. This way, even if your bag is misplaced or stolen, you can quickly report the loss and minimize the risk of identity theft.
Travel Insurance for Luggage: Consider purchasing travel insurance that covers lost, stolen, or damaged luggage. Standard travel insurance policies often include coverage for checked baggage, but it's essential to review the terms and conditions. Some policies may have specific requirements, such as reporting the loss within a certain timeframe or providing proof of purchase for expensive items. By having adequate insurance, you can have peace of mind knowing that your belongings are protected, and you won't be left without essential items if something happens to your luggage.
Secure Your Accommodation: When choosing accommodation, opt for places with secure entry systems, such as keycard access or receptionists who can assist with luggage storage. Avoid leaving your bags unattended in hotel rooms, and consider using a hotel safe if available. If you need to leave your luggage in the lobby, ensure it is under the hotel's supervision and consider taking a photo of your belongings for reference.
Be Mindful of Public Transportation: When using public transportation, such as buses, trains, or planes, keep your luggage close and be aware of your surroundings. Avoid placing valuable items in overhead compartments or visible storage areas, as these may be easier targets for thieves. Instead, consider carrying a smaller bag with your essentials and storing the rest of your luggage in the hold or under the seat in front of you.

Travel Assistance: Access to 24/7 support, legal aid, and emergency services worldwide
When planning your honeymoon, considering travel insurance is a wise decision that can provide valuable peace of mind. While it might seem like an extra expense, the benefits of having travel assistance and coverage for potential emergencies can be invaluable. Here's why you should consider this option:
24/7 Support and Emergency Services: One of the most critical aspects of travel insurance is the access it provides to emergency services and support. During your honeymoon, you might encounter unexpected situations, such as medical emergencies, lost luggage, or travel delays. With travel insurance, you gain access to a 24/7 assistance hotline. This service can help you navigate these challenges efficiently. For instance, if you or your partner fall ill or get injured during your trip, the insurance provider can assist in finding medical care, arranging emergency transportation if needed, and even providing translations or legal advice if required. This level of support ensures that you can focus on enjoying your honeymoon without worrying about the logistics of dealing with unforeseen circumstances.
Legal Aid: Traveling to a new place often involves navigating unfamiliar laws and regulations. This is especially important for honeymoons, as you might be in a different country with different legal systems. Travel insurance with legal aid coverage can provide assistance in various legal matters. For example, if you encounter a dispute with a local business, need to file a complaint, or require guidance on local laws and customs, the insurance company's legal experts can offer valuable advice. This feature ensures that you have the necessary support to handle any legal issues that may arise during your romantic getaway.
